Every other year, Theatre UAB conducts a search for new and original full-length plays confronting racial or ethnic issues, especially those calling for ethnically diverse and/or multi-racial casting.
The Apsey Award consists of a $1000 prize plus a staged reading and audience talk-back at Theatre UAB.
Recent winners:
- 2005: The Poetry of Pizza by Deborah Brevoort
- 2007: Valu-Mart by Sean O'Leary
- 2009: We Three by Paul Shoulberg
- 2011: A to Z by Monica Raymond
